Basics of Budgeting

The foundation of financial management is budgeting. Your road map to financial success is your budget. It's a straightforward but effective application that enables you to keep track of your earnings and outgoings to make sure you're living within your means. 

Gather all of your financial data, including your sources of income and monthly expenses, to get started. Create a realistic budget after that, leaving money for savings and discretionary spending while allocating money for necessities like rent, groceries, and utilities.

Prudent Debt Management

Debt management is a critical component of financial health. While some level of debt may be necessary, it's essential to manage it wisely. Start by understanding your current debt obligations, including interest rates and repayment terms. 

Prioritize high-interest debts and work towards paying them down faster. Consider consolidating or refinancing loans to secure better terms if possible. By taking control of your debt, you'll reduce financial stress and free up resources for saving and investing.

Investing and saving

A proactive attitude to saving and investing is necessary and a major aspect on how to take care of your finances to accumulating wealth and achieving financial security. To start, set up an emergency fund to cover unforeseen costs. 

After you've developed an emergency fund, concentrate on long-term investments and savings. Investigate investing opportunities like stocks, bonds, or mutual funds that fit your risk appetite and financial objectives. 

Your portfolio can be diversified to spread risk and increase returns over time. To take advantage of compounding, regularly contribute to your savings and investing accounts.

Protecting Your Financial Future

Financial security is not just about accumulating wealth; it's also about protecting what you've worked hard to build. Consider purchasing insurance policies that provide coverage for health, life, disability, and property. Adequate insurance safeguards you and your loved ones from unexpected financial setbacks. 

Further more, estate planning is essential for ensuring that your assets are distributed according to your wishes upon your passing. Seek legal advice to create a comprehensive estate plan that addresses your unique circumstances.

Monitoring and Adjusting Your Financial Plan

Financial management is an ongoing process. Regularly review your budget, goals, and investment portfolio to ensure they remain aligned with your evolving financial situation. Life changes, such as marriage, parenthood, or career shifts, may necessitate adjustments to your financial plan.

Be flexible and adaptable, and don't hesitate to seek professional advice when needed. Monitoring your financial plan allows you to stay on course and make informed decisions to secure your financial future.
